In a recent article … WebOct 13, 2024 · A recharacterization is treating a contribution made to one type of IRA as having been made to a different type of IRA. A recharacterization is completed through a reportable transfer of all or part of a contribution, plus earnings or loss, from a traditional or SEP IRA to a Roth IRA, or from a Roth IRA to a traditional or SEP IRA.

WebA conversion of a traditional IRA to a Roth IRA, and a rollover from any other eligible retirement plan to a Roth IRA, made in tax years beginning after December 31, 2024, cannot be recharacterized as having been made to a traditional IRA. WebRecharacterizations from a Roth IRA to a traditional IRA—and vice versa—are reported on 2 different tax forms: Form 1099-R reports the distribution. Form 5498 reports the contribution. Here is what you need to know. A recharacterization must be a direct transfer from the Roth IRA to a traditional IRA. You cannot do a recharacterization as a 60-day rollover.
